Abstract
In order to solve the problem of complex control strategies and high voltage fluctuations of DC bus ofhybrid TSMC,for which a simplified method of pulse width modulation(PWM)was proposed in the rectifier stage.This method can simplify the calculation of duty and can make the rectifier stage to output direct voltage with constantaverage value in every switching cycle,and the SVPWM modulation method is convenient to be used in level inverterstage,so it contains the advantage of the conventional method. Finally,modeling and simulation was carried out inMatlab/Simullink to verify the correctness of the new modulation method.
